英英释义
aflame[ ə'fleim ]
adj.keenly excited (especially sexually) or indicating excitement
"he was aflame with desire"
同义词:ablazearoused
lighted up by or as by fire or flame
"even the car's tires were aflame"
同义词:ablaze(p)afire(p)aflare(p)alight(p)blazingburningflamingon fire(p)
